Subject: Pooling cut-over done — plugin heads up

Hi all,

Quick note: the Branwick gateway finished its move to the new connection pooler last night. Zero downtime, a few retries during the flip, nothing scary. Plugin authors should verify their adapters respect the new idle-timeout behavior before the next release. For reference, the pooler now runs with the following settings.

service settings:
PRAIX_LOG_LEVEL=error
PRAIX_METRICS_HOST=metrics.praix.qorvelcorp.corp
PRAIX_POOL_SIZE=16

TURN-208: Gatevale turnstile counters at the Merrow Field pilot double-count when a rotation reverses mid-cycle. Attendance totals drift roughly 2% high per event. The debounce window fix is implemented, reviewed by Ilsa, and soak-tested across two simulated match days without drift. Ready for your cut; the candidate build is identified below.

trace token, tagag-tafog: htk6_5ed18c

Subject: Handover — Tollgrove rules engine release

Hi Ansel,

You're on call for the Tollgrove 7.1 rollout tonight. The shipping-fee rule packs are built, tested, and staged; promotion is scheduled for 02:00. If a pack fails verification, roll back to 7.0 and page me. Everything is signed through the standard pipeline. The deploy key for verification is below.

deploy key for yajop-fahop: bky3_h1v

## Step 2: Normalize build agent clocks

The Forgepath pipeline previously tolerated up to five minutes of clock skew between agents, which caused artifact timestamps to sort incorrectly and broke incremental builds. This step enables NTP enforcement on every agent and rejects builds from hosts that drift beyond the new limit. Reviewers should confirm that the skew guard is enabled in all pools. The enforced settings are as follows.

deployment values, kajep-kageg:
[praix]
host = praix.paliqcorp.corp
user = praix_svc
database = praix_prod